Students in Ms. Gross’ class are wrapping up their Descriptive Writing Unit with a creative culminating activity! Working in pairs, students became real estate agents for Reindeer Realty, writing vivid descriptive paragraphs to “sell” their gingerbread houses.

To bring their writing to life, students designed and built their gingerbread houses using cardboard and other materials, focusing on details that matched their descriptions.

On Friday, 6th and 7th grade students will tour the neighborhood and “purchase” the houses that best match the written descriptions. 🎄🏠✏️

Starting TOMORROW, Holgate Middle School will once again battle it out for the ultimate title of Coin Wars Champion—all while raising money to support HMS students and fulfill local Angel Tree wishes! ❤️🎄

Here’s how it works:
🔹 Coins = Positive Points for your homeroom
🔹 Paper money = Negative Points for other homerooms (👀 sabotage time…)
🔹 Top homerooms earn a spot in the Dodgeball Showdown on Dec. 23

Buckets will be out during homeroom all week (Dec.8-11).

All money raised goes straight to supporting HMS families this holiday season. 💛
